I am using the program on an iMac and am not able to find the information necessary to print a list of the movies I own.

First, you make the filtered search list the movies you own (you could use the shortcut "owned" just above). Then you click the button "export this list" (this button is available only when the filtered search lists your personal data, like what you own, what you've rated, etc...).
